It's more so of repairing the culture which was badly needed in Detroit when Campbell arrived. Their roster was completely gutted a year ago, and Detroit has made a very clear effort to fill those spots with young, developmental pieces who are still learning through mistakes.
I should note that their offense is pretty good. They are 8th in the NFL on Rushing Yards per game, 7th in the NFL on Passing Yards per game, and 3rd in the NFL at Points per game. At this stage, they are still investing in developing their youth and they're trying to weather the injury storms.
Their biggest issue is their defense as they're giving up 34 points per game. That is last in the NFL. If they have a middle of the pack scoring defense, their record would have been better than 1-4.
I think Detroit will finish with 6 wins.
